On Thu, Apr 13, 2017 at 04:49:49PM +0200, Juergen Gross wrote:
> Revert commit 72a9b186292 ("xen: Remove event channel notification
> through Xen PCI platform device") as the original analysis was wrong
> that all the removed code isn't in use any more. As commit da72ff5bfcb0
> ("partially revert xen: Remove event channel notification through Xen
> PCI platform device") reverted already some parts of it revert this
> commit, too.
>
> It is still necessary for old Xen versions (< 4.0) and for being able
> to run the Linux kernel as dom0 in a nested Xen environment.
Is there a commit in Linus's tree that matches this revert as well?
